So this craft has great maneouvrability and decent speed. Also take time to appreciate the stealth design I put on the plane. Its also capable of taking off and landing on an aircraft carrier.
AG:
1. Arresting hook
2, 3, and 4. Flares
Trim down. Deploy missiles.
That's it. It's so simple.
Some notable features:
Custom airbrakes
Neat slanting fuselage and geometric shape for stealthy design.
Shiny fuselage (aircraft relfections must be set on high), thanks to Simon Glaser for making the blocks shiny.
Modified exhaust flame. Instead of orange-yellow mix, I changed it to purple, because why not?
